The MM850-5 Infrared Laser Diode Module is a cutting-edge, high-performance product designed for a wide range of applications, offering an output power of 5mW at a wavelength of 850nm. This micro 850nm laser module is a testament to modern engineering, combining compact size with impressive functionality.
The heart of this module is a high-quality laser diode emitting at 850nm, a wavelength ideally suited for various industrial, medical, and research applications. The 5mW output power provides enough intensity for many tasks while maintaining safety and efficiency.
The MM850-5 is housed in a sturdy, miniature package, making it easily integrable into various systems. Despite its small size, it boasts exceptional thermal management to ensure stable and reliable operation, even under continuous use.
This module is driven by a constant current source, ensuring consistent performance and a long lifespan for the laser diode. The drive current can be easily adjusted, offering flexibility for fine-tuning the output power to your specific needs.

1. **Wavelength**: Operates at 850nm, a wavelength ideal for various applications such as biomedical, telecommunications, and industrial sensing, due to its deeper penetration into tissues and low absorption by water.
2. **Power Output**: Offers a power output of 5mW, which is suitable for some low-power applications without causing significant heat buildup.
3. **Compact Size**: The MM850-5 Module is designed to be compact, making it easier to integrate into various devices and systems.
4. **Robustness**: Infrared lasers are less affected by environmental factors such as dust and moisture, making the MM850-5 suitable for use in rugged conditions.
Cons:1. **Low Power**: With a power output of only 5mW, the MM850-5 may not be sufficient for high-power applications such as laser cutting or engraving.
2. **Safety Concerns**: While infrared light is generally considered safe for human eyes, prolonged exposure or high-intensity exposure can cause eye damage. Therefore, proper safety measures should be in place when using this laser.
3. **Efficiency**: Infrared lasers are less efficient than visible lasers, requiring more electrical power to produce the same amount of light output.
4. **Cost**: The cost of infrared lasers, especially those with higher power output, can be significantly higher than their visible light counterparts.
Conclusion:The MM850-5 Module Infrared Laser Diode is a suitable choice for low-power applications where deep penetration into materials is desired, such as biomedical research, telecommunications, and industrial sensing. However, for high-power applications, a more powerful laser may be necessary. Additionally, it is essential to prioritize safety measures when working with this laser due to potential eye damage.

8mm long, smaller than a 22 caliber bullet. Optic output 5mw, wave length 850nm comes with adjustable focus plastic lens, brass housing, flying leads or spring, sealed with thermal conductive epoxy.
